EDUCATION BS in Environmental Science with minor in Watershed Science and Environmental Engineering from the New York State College of Environmental Science and Forestry, Syracuse NY MINI-BIO Meredith is an AmeriCorps intern at the Coos Watershed Association through the Northwest Service Academy through November of 2010. After graduating from college she spent 5 months as an invasive species monitor for the New Hampshire Rivers Council. Before taking this AmeriCorps position she spent almost two months traveling in Spain and Mexico visiting friends. Meredith has conducted research in renewable energy systems and sustainable living. Her hobbies include hiking, skiing, running, and enjoying nature. WHAT MEREDITH DOES AT COOSWA At the Coos Watershed Association Meredith is in charge of updating the website, coordinating the Friends of the Coos Watershed group, developing outreach materials such as the annual reports and quarterly newsletters, and coordinating presentations and workshops. She is bringing her passion for low-impact development into this job too. If you join the Friends of the Coos Watershed group you can be involved in watershed-friendly, low-impact development projects such as the installation of rain gardens to capture and slow-down excess runoff from large parking lots.
